To the incoming director: this summarizes where the Westmarch review stands. I have completed account-level reviews for the top twelve customers; the remaining eight are scheduled over the next two weeks with Dale Ferris coordinating. Pipeline data in the Corveta dashboard is current as of last Friday. Watch the Ashfield renewal — pricing tension there is real. Quarterly targets were set conservatively and I recommend keeping them until you have met each territory lead. Context on our broader direction is appended below.

internal memo for kawip-hadug: Headcount on the Wenwyn team goes from 7 to 140 by the end of January. Gross margin on Wenwyn came in at 20 percent against a plan of 15 percent.

**Q: Can my plugin vendor third-party fonts?**

A: Yes, with limits. Fonts bundled into a Glyphcart plugin must ship with a license file in the same directory, must not be subset in a way that strips the license metadata, and must pass the packager's font audit step. Dynamic font fetching at runtime is rejected at review. Variable fonts are fine; bitmap fonts are not. The approved font list and the audit tool's configuration for the Glyphcart build pipeline are maintained on the internal page here:

operations page: https://jenkins.zemvarcloud.local/job/merge_requests/repo/build/73930b4b30f0a8ed

Subject: Handover — image slimming work

Heads up for on-call: ownership of the container image slimming effort for the Brindlewave services has moved off the platform rotation. Base image trims and layer-cache changes now go through a single reviewer, so route any related alerts or failed builds accordingly. Effective this sprint, the responsible contact is listed below.

named custodian: Oliath Ralax